**About the role**:
As part of Singleton Hospital, you’ll have the opportunity to gain varied experience across multiple departments including the Surgical Unit, Theatres, Recovery, Day Stay, Maternity, Renal Unit and Medical Ward. Working on a casual basis, you’ll enjoy flexibility with shifts allocated according to roster vacancies and service needs. This is a dynamic rural health facility where no two days are the same, giving you the chance to build skills and confidence across a wide range of clinical areas.
